Overview
The Jianhu JTH-100P-A is a fully programmable temperature and humidity environmental test chamber engineered for precision reliability validation across industrial R&D, quality assurance, and compliance testing laboratories. It operates on the fundamental principle of controlled thermal and hygrometric conditioning—using independent heating, refrigeration, humidification, and dehumidification subsystems—to replicate real-world climatic stress profiles with high reproducibility. Designed for accelerated life testing, environmental stress screening (ESS), and qualification per international standards, this chamber enables systematic evaluation of material integrity, dimensional stability, electrical performance, and functional resilience under defined thermal-hygrometric cycles. Its robust architecture supports both static condition holding and dynamic ramp-soak profiling—including multi-step temperature/humidity sequences with programmable dwell times, rate limits, and loop repetitions—making it suitable for automotive component validation (e.g., ISO 16750-4), electronics thermal cycling (JEDEC JESD22-A104), and polymer aging studies.

Sample Compatibility & Compliance
The JTH-100P-A accommodates a broad range of physical samples—from PCB assemblies and automotive ECUs to elastomeric seals, lithium-ion battery modules, and medical device housings—within its 100 L internal workspace (45 × 40 × 55 cm). Its design adheres to mechanical and environmental test requirements specified in GB/T 2423 (China National Standard), GJB 150 (Chinese Military Standard), IEC 60068-2 (Environmental Testing), ISO 16750-4 (Road Vehicles), ASTM D4332 (Conditioning of Plastics), UL 746 (Polymeric Materials), and MIL-STD-810H Method 502.8 (Temperature), Method 507.6 (Humidity). The chamber supports GLP-compliant workflows through traceable calibration records and optional audit-ready data export (CSV/Excel), though native 21 CFR Part 11 compliance requires third-party software validation.
Software & Data Management
The embedded controller firmware provides full-cycle programmability—including up to 99 segments per profile, 999 loops, and user-defined ramp rates (0.1–5.0°C/min, 0.1–10% RH/min). Real-time operational data (chamber temperature, relative humidity, setpoints, alarm status) are displayed continuously and logged internally at configurable intervals (1–60 sec). Export is supported via USB flash drive or RS-232 to PC-based applications such as Jianhu’s optional LabView-compatible DAQ software or generic SCADA platforms. All logged datasets include timestamped metadata (start time, operator ID, program name), enabling traceability for internal QA audits or regulatory submissions.

FAQ
What is the difference between P-type and S-type models?
The “P” designation indicates a touch-screen programmable controller with high-resolution temperature/humidity control (0.01°C / ±0.1% RH), while “S” refers to microprocessor-based digital display units with lower resolution (1°C / ±1% RH) and fixed-setpoint operation.
Can the chamber operate at −70°C continuously?
Yes—when configured with Option E (−70 to 150°C), the dual-stage refrigeration system maintains continuous operation at −70°C with humidity disabled, subject to ambient room conditions ≤25°C and ≤60% RH.
Is calibration certification included with shipment?
A factory calibration report (traceable to NIM, China) is provided; ISO/IEC 17025-accredited third-party calibration is available upon request.
What maintenance is required for long-term reliability?
Recommended quarterly checks include condensate drain line inspection, air filter cleaning, refrigerant pressure verification, and verification of sensor drift using NIST-traceable reference hygrometers and dry-well calibrators.
Does the chamber support Ethernet or USB host connectivity?
Standard configuration includes only RS-232; Ethernet or USB host interfaces are available as optional hardware upgrades with corresponding firmware updates.
